That was not a game engine issue. It was an availability of objects issue; for the station signs, there are 100 available (100 object files refering to 100 texture files). I can place 2000 signs in the network if I like to do so, but they still refer to 100 texture files, so a maximum of 100 station names can be shown.
That should be enough for any map, but Rijndam has grown a bit..... :roll:
